My husband Andy and I have been in business making and selling pottery from our home in Port Orchard, WA since 1991. In May of 2005, I opened an Ebay store to have another sales outlet for our pottery and garden markers. Soon after that I discovered and fell in love with Peruvian jewelry which I added to the store. Since then I have added the pearl jewelry, purse hangers, fashion jewelry, Millefiori jewelry, Andy's books, and the dog related items. The last was a given since we are dog lovers, participating in many dog sports with our 3 dogs.
Andy's dog Henry, a 14 year old Champion Belgian Tervuren, is now retired so Andy has taken to summer cross country motorcycle trips on his Valkyrie instead of dog shows. He has finally decided to let go of some of his enormous book collection. Thus the "Andy"s Books" catagory.
My biggest interest is the dogs. I have a 12 year old Belgian Sheepdog, Rainy, and a 11 year old red Border Collie, Sunny. Rainy is a conformation champion and has performance titles in agility, rally, K9 musical freestyle, and flyball. She has also graced the cover of Clean Run magazine. My gem Sunny, is a rescue dog from the streets. He has AKC and NADAC agility titles and is getting ready for rally.
For 13 years I have worked for internationally known trainer Dawn Jecs, teaching classes and assisting with workshops and camps at her training facility in Puyallup, WA. We also go on the road doing seminars and workshops in different states. This is why I have Dawn's Choose to Heel dog training books, videos, and dvds in my store.

Pottery
Andy and I make all of the pottery in my listings. Each piece, excluding the plant markers, is permanently signed and dated by whichever of us made it. We each make and glaze our own pots. We each specialize in different items with some overlap. Andy makes all of the dispenser bottles, mortar & pestle sets and large pieces. I make all of the butter keepers, sponge holders, mugs and items with lids. We can do special orders if you see something that you want in a different color or size please ask.
Our line of plant markers has been very popular. We also do special orders for plant names that we do not stock.
Special orders on pottery and plant markers can take up to 3 months. We have a very large kiln and must have it full to fire with the cost of fuel so high.
